Colleen Maderos, transportation program manager at the Cape Cod Commission, told attendees the commission — which staffs the Cape Cod Metropolitan Planning Organization (MPO) — had released two draft planning documents and opened a 14‑day public comment period ending May 12.

"These documents are now out for a 14 day public comment period ending on May 12," Maderos said.

David Nolan, senior transportation planner at the Cape Cod Commission, led an overview of the Unified Planning Work Program for federal fiscal year 2026. He said the UPWP "is the scope of work for MPO staff on a year to year basis," and described the program as a single document that lists the region's significant transportation planning activities, regardless of lead organization or funding source.
